Output 95fbadd65aaac253a303a412f1c8f144a676033fbb60e111fc7c2974f86bb60c:3

value
2951126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e40b72e29646e343ee8a543c98868a871065a9 OP_EQUAL
address
3ByvnrUTeEnxsbpLCuCQa4nrgmZNBJjnbj
transaction
95fbadd65aaac253a303a412f1c8f144a676033fbb60e111fc7c2974f86bb60c